Transaction 376c28e292fcef5e989c44debd2bbb6baa7a380d4aa4f166679a5e08c7ed7a08
3 Input
2 Outputs
- 376c28e292fcef5e989c44debd2bbb6baa7a380d4aa4f166679a5e08c7ed7a08:0
- 376c28e292fcef5e989c44debd2bbb6baa7a380d4aa4f166679a5e08c7ed7a08:1
value 1126490670
address 3BMEXQaz1XqBxf2karRkMPsEmZqxt2yk9X
value 1373309330
address 1GuHui2dWZussgxAueqU2TxM9FBaz5C5d